Output eb3baaefc847958dbbcfd0d09e11db7a47d10237b8fe3b5678b767e4adfa8f41:1

value
1555717020
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72975949975e30f29c41a8a4d5e568ae26e05d7c OP_EQUAL
address
3C8vGJvwQWKNRDwSVkKoX7FhG6uSighUgd
transaction
eb3baaefc847958dbbcfd0d09e11db7a47d10237b8fe3b5678b767e4adfa8f41
confirmations
346944
spent
true